Hey Fredo, I found a good starting point for your injectors. Closest I could find to your size lol.

FIC Bluemax 1450s

Scaling (92 oct) 1329 (E85) 1008

Latency: From the data sheet included with the injectors
2.784
2.112
1.680
1.368
1.176
0.984
0.816
